The J. Lewis Crozer Library offers its Community Room and grounds to the public for a variety of purposes, including educational, cultural, intellectual, charitable, advocacy, civic, religious, and political events. This availability is provided under the condition that these activities do not interfere with or disrupt Library-sponsored programs and services. It should be noted that permission to use the Community Room or grounds does not constitute an endorsement by the Library of the policies or beliefs of any group or organization utilizing the space.
The following guidelines apply to the use of the Community Room and grounds:
- The J. Lewis Crozer Library prioritizes its own programs and events in reserving the Community Room and grounds, reserving the right to reschedule or adjust confirmed bookings to support primary activities.
- Use of the Community Room and grounds must not disrupt library operations or threaten the safety of staff, library users, or property. All attendees must adhere to the J. Lewis Crozer Library’s Rules of Conduct.
- Reservations are accepted up to one (1) month in advance. For bookings within 72 hours of the event, contact the library during standard operational hours. Availability is on a first-come, first-served basis.
- Please notify the library of cancellations as soon as possible. A full refund is issued for cancellations made at least 24 hours before the event.
- The responsible party should submit a signed copy of this policy and application in person or via email or fax.
- At least one (1) adult, aged 18 or older, must be present throughout the event.
- Direct monetary transactions, including admission fees or sales, are prohibited unless in collaboration with the Library.
- Promotional materials must include the sponsoring organization’s contact details and not imply library sponsorship. The library’s contact information should not be used.
- Groups must use the room and grounds only for the reserved time, ensuring departure by the library’s closing time. They are responsible for setup, cleanup, trash disposal, and restoring the room to its original state.
- Non-alcoholic beverages and light refreshments are permitted, provided they do not disrupt library operations. The Library does not provide these.
- AV equipment and technology are available upon request; please arrange at least two (2) weeks in advance.
- All organizations or groups shall indemnify, defend, and hold harmless the J. Lewis Crozer Library and its management and staff from and against any and all claims, suits, actions of any kind, arising from any negligent act, omission, or error of the organization or group resulting in or relating to personal injuries, property damage, theft, or loss arising from the organization/group’s use of the Library Community Room or library grounds.
Adherence to these guidelines ensures a harmonious environment for all library users, staff, and visitors.
FEES
No fees will be charged to nonprofit groups using the room or grounds for up to three (3) hours. Similarly, government agencies and City of Chester departments will not be charged fees for non-commercial use.
| Length of Time | Nonprofit Groups | For-profit Groups |
| Up to 3 hours | No charge | $25 |
| 3 to 6 hours | $35 | $35 |
| 6 to 9 hours | $35 | $45 |
